This bill amends Minnesota Statutes 2024, specifically section 609.666, to enhance public safety by establishing stricter regulations on the storage of loaded firearms. The amendments clarify definitions related to firearms, children, and what constitutes a "loaded" firearm. Notably, the previous language that exempted firearms incapable of being fired by a child has been removed, emphasizing the importance of secure storage regardless of the firearm's capability.
Additionally, the bill introduces new provisions that make it a gross misdemeanor for individuals to negligently store or leave a loaded firearm in locations accessible to children or individuals prohibited from possessing firearms. This change aims to prevent unauthorized access to firearms, thereby reducing the risk of accidents and ensuring that firearms are stored safely away from those who should not have access to them.
